Essential Team Strategies for Success in CSGO
In CSGO, teamwork is crucial for success. One of the fundamental strategies is effective communication. Clear, concise, and timely communication can make the difference between victory and defeat. Players should utilize voice chat or text chat to relay information about enemy positions, health status, and strategic plans. Furthermore, establishing roles within the team can enhance coordination and efficiency. For instance, designating players as AWPer, fraggers, or support can leverage each individual’s strengths and streamline the team's approach towards objectives.
Another essential strategy is the implementation of map control. Understanding and controlling key areas on the map can significantly increase your team's chances of winning rounds. Regular practice of map callouts and familiarization with common hiding spots can aid in executing successful strategies. Additionally, incorporating training sessions focused on team strategies such as executes, retakes, and eco rounds can further solidify your team’s performance. By focusing on these strategies, your team can build synergy and develop a winning mindset, vital for dominating in CSGO.

Top 5 Communication Techniques to Enhance Team Play in CSGO
Effective communication is essential for success in any team-based game, especially in CS:GO. Here are the top 5 communication techniques that can significantly enhance team play and coordination:
- Clear Callouts: Using precise callouts for locations (like A site, B site, mid) helps teammates understand enemy positions quickly.
- Voice Communication: Make the most of voice chat to relay vital information rapidly. Don’t just state the obvious; provide as much context as possible.
- Map Awareness: Regularly update your teammates on your position and any changes on the map. For instance, if you notice an enemy lurking in a particular area, inform the team immediately.
- Strategic Planning: Before the game starts, have a quick strategy session. Discuss roles and tactics to ensure everyone knows their assignments from the get-go.
- Positive Reinforcement: Encourage your teammates with positive feedback. A well-timed compliment can boost morale and inspire better performance.
Incorporating these communication techniques in your gameplay can lead to a more cohesive team effort and improved outcomes in CS:GO. Remember, successful communication is not just about speaking but also about listening and adapting. How to Build Trust and Coordination in Your CSGO Team
Building trust in your CSGO team starts with open communication. Players should feel comfortable discussing their ideas, strategies, and concerns without the fear of being judged. To foster this environment, consider having regular team meetings where everyone can share their thoughts. Additionally, implementing a coordinated practice schedule helps in aligning goals and expectations. Trust can also be strengthened through positive reinforcement: acknowledge your teammates' efforts and celebrate small victories together. This not only boosts morale but also creates a sense of belonging within the team.
Coordination is another crucial element in a successful CSGO team. Establishing clear roles and responsibilities for each player can significantly improve teamwork. For example, you might have a designated AWPer, a support player, and an entry fragger. Utilizing tools like voice chat and team management platforms can help maintain clear communication during matches. Moreover, practicing specific strategies as a team can enhance coordination; consider dedicating time to rehearsing various plays and scenarios. Consistent practice and understanding each other's playstyles will lead to better synergy when it matters most.
